According to the police, the strangers smashed a glass emergency glass door with a stone to get inside the new middle school. They blocked the sinks and turned on the faucets in three classrooms located on the first floor of the south wing.
The rooms with parquet floors were under water. As a result, the classes on the ground floor were also badly damaged, according to the Styrian police. The strangers also damaged a screen, a beamer and the copier, and two fire extinguishers were emptied in the school.
Investigators estimate the damage to property at tens of thousands of euros. The perpetrators may have been at school between Friday and Sunday afternoon. According to initial investigations, nothing was stolen.
